Thompson Submachine GunGeneral John T. Thompson, agraduate of West Point, began hisresearch in 1915 for an automaticweapon to supply the Americanmilitary. World War I was drag-ging on and casualties weremounting. Having served in the

U.S. Army's ordnance supplies and logistics,General Thompson understood that greater fire-power was needed to end the war.

Thompson was driven to create a lightweight, fullyautomatic firearm that would be effective againstthe contemporary machine gun. His idea was "aone-man, hand held machine gun. A trenchbroom!" The first shipment of Thompson prototypesarrived on the dock in New York for shipment toEurope on November 11, 1918 the day that the Warended.

In 1919, Thompson directed Auto Ordnance tomodify the gun for nonmilitary use. The gun, clas-sified a "submachine gun" to denote a small, hand-held, fully automatic firearm chambered for pistolammunition, was officially named the "Thompsonsubmachine gun" to honor the man most responsi-ble for its creation.

With military and police sales low, Auto Ordnancesold its submachine guns through every legal out-let it could. A Thompson submachine gun could bepurchased either by mail order, or from the localhardware or sporting goods store.

Dillinger's ChoiceWhile Auto Ordnance wasselling the Thompson subma-chine gun in the open marketin the '20s, Gen. Thompsonwas uncomfortably aware ofwhat the guns could do if inthe wrong hands. To his dis-tress, the submachine gunturned out to be the weaponchosen by gangsters.

The "Tommy Gun", literally,made the '20s roar.Possessing tremendous fire-power, the Thompson subma-chine gun was an effectiveweapon. The Thompson wasused by gangsters, such asJohn Dillinger, Al Capone and Baby Face Nelson.

TrustedCompanion forTroopsIt was, also, inthe mid '20sthat theThompson sub-machine gunwas adoptedfor service byan official mili-tary branch ofthe govern-

ment. The U.S. Coast Guard issued Thompsons topatrol boats along the eastern seaboard. In 1928,Auto Ordnance made a new Navy model to beused by Marines on Naval gunboats.

World War II began, and theArmy recognized the needfor the submachine gun. TheThompson, simplified andmore durable with the buttstock removed and a 30 shotstick, became the constantcompanion of American sol-diers. Story, after story, tellshow it was the fire of theThompson submachine gunthat protected the villages,saved the troops and wonthe battles in Europe and thePacific.

Historical ResearchKahr Arms is proud to preserve the legacy of Auto-Ordnance Corporation, the original maker of thefamous Thompson submachine gun. To assure thehistorical accuracy of the Auto-Ordnance design,Kahr researched the original engineering draw-ings. Hundreds of U.S. military microfiche andhand drawings of the Thompson models datingback to 1919 were examined.

Thompson Short Barrel Rifles must be shipped to a Class 2 manufacturer or Class 3 dealerdirectly from our factory in Worcester, MA. The transfer paperwork between Kahr Arms/Auto-Ordnance and the dealer, known as a Form 3, must be completed and approved by the NFAbranch,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co and Firearms (BATF) before the Thompson SBR can beshipped to the dealer. The customer needs to pay a $200 transfer fee directly to the BATF.Your local dealer can assist you in this process.

The Thompson Custom 1911 frames are machined on high precisioncomputerized machinery from a 420 stainless steel casting and a 7075 solid aluminum block. The slide is machined from a solid stainless steel billetutilizing specialized tooling to reduce set-up and refixturing. The combinationof high precision equipment and fewer set-ups result in a higher quality andmore consistent final product at a lower price.

The slide and frame are finished in an attractive matte finish, markings arelaser-engraved including the distinctive Thompson bullet logo on the slide.Front and rear sights are black with serrations and are dovetailed into theslide. The ejection port is flared and the slide has front and rear serrationsmachined at a slight angle. The mainspring housing is checkered and thefrontstrap is machine checkered at 20 lines per inch. Additional featuresinclude an adjustable trigger, combat hammer, stainless steel, full-lengthrecoil guide rod, extended beavertail grip safety; extended magazinerelease; checkered laminate grips with a Thompson bullet logo inlay and acheckered slide stop lever.

The Auto-Ordnance M1 .30 Caliber carbine isproduced in Kahr’s state-of-the-art manufacturingplant in Worcester, MA. The Auto-Ordnancecarbines are produced using newly manufacturedparts on high precision computerized machinery.

The AOM110W and AOM120W models feature abirch stock and handguard, parkerized receiverand flip style rear sight.

The AOM130 and AOM140 models featureAmerican walnut stock and handguard, parkerizedreceiver, flip style rear sight, flat bolt and a barrelband.

Markings include the following: Auto-Ordnance,Worcester, MA behind the rear sight; U.S. Carbine,Cal. 30 M1 on the receiver in front of the bolt andthe serial number is stamped on the left side of thereceiver.
